Circle Introduces Higher USDC Cash-Out Fees Impacting Large-Scale Transactions

Circle, the issuer of USD Coin (USDC), has adjusted its fee structure for cashing out on USDC, targeting primarily institutional investors and those involved in high-volume trading. This marks the second increase within a year, raising concerns among significant stakeholders about the future cost implications of their digital asset strategies.

Impact on Institutional Investors

The revised fees now start at 0.03% per transaction and can go up to 0.1% for transactions exceeding $15 million. This fee structure is aimed at addressing the surging demand for liquidity as more institutions turn to digital assets. Despite the increase, Circle offers a no-fee option for those who can afford to wait up to two days for transactions, which might still appeal to smaller investors or less urgent transactions.

Circle's Strategic Moves Amidst Market Changes

In response to increasing competition within the stablecoin market and as part of its broader strategy, Circle is pressing forward with its plans for an initial public offering (IPO) and relocating its headquarters to Wall Street by 2025. These moves are seen as steps to bolster its position as a leading stablecoin by aligning closely with regulatory frameworks and expanding its market reach.

Market Response and Competitive Landscape

The stablecoin market is currently dominated by Tether (USDT), which holds a significant market share compared to USDC. Both stablecoins implement similar fee structures for large-scale transactions, which indicates a market trend towards standardizing costs associated with high-value dealings. However , Circle's recent decisions come at a time when its market share has slightly declined, influenced by regulatory actions and the broader financial scrutiny following incidents like the FTX collapse.
